Apply

Software Engineer I (Contact Experience, Fullstack)

Posted 17 days agoViewed

View full description

💎 Seniority level: Entry, Previous work or internship experience

📍 Location: United States

💸 Salary: 102000.0 - 142000.0 USD per year

🔍 Industry: Financial technology

🏢 Company: Affirm👥 1001-5000💰 Post-IPO Equity almost 4 years ago🫂 Last layoff almost 2 years agoLendingFinancial ServicesPaymentsFinTech

🗣️ Languages: English

⏳ Experience: Previous work or internship experience

🪄 Skills: AWSPythonHTMLCSSJavascriptKotlinKubernetesMySQLSalesforceCommunication SkillsCollaborationWritten communication

Requirements:
  • You have previous work or internship experience working on both front-end and back-end development using HTML, CSS, JavaScript, Salesforce Lightning Web Components (or other front development frameworks like React) and server-side languages like Salesforce Apex, Python or Kotlin.
  • You are familiar with the building blocks of distributed systems, and the technologies like AWS, MySQL, and Kubernetes.
  • You have mastered taking a simple problem or business scenario into a solution that interacts with multiple software components, and executing it by writing clear, easily understood, well-tested, and extensible code.
  • You are comfortable navigating a large code base, debugging others' code, and providing feedback to other engineers through code reviews.
  • You take ownership of your growth, proactively seeking feedback from your team, your manager, and your stakeholders.
  • You have strong verbal and written communication skills that support effective collaboration with our global engineering team.
Responsibilities:
  • With the support of your team, you will work on tasks that contribute to the team's projects and goals.
  • You will work collaboratively and proactively with your team and stakeholders, bringing them along for your work and helping to create visibility and dialog regarding the risks and trade-offs related to your work.
  • You will strike the right balance of speed and quality in your work, ensuring that we hit our business goals while protecting our systems from downtime.
  • You will contribute to a sense of community on your team by engaging in growth and development activities.
Apply